We face the issue, that any session expires after 10 minutes.
In Sessions.log the exit reason is "Session expired after idle time".
I read some articles in the community here, but the recommendations there are not working. E.g. the setting for the QlikView Server QSS in Documents for the document timeout is 480 mins, in Performance for maximum inactive session time is 1800 seconds.
Other timeout settings are either default - which usually is much higher than 10 mins - or increased to at least 30 mins.
We are running QlikView May 2021 SR2, without IIS, on a Windows 2019 server.
Does anyone have an idea where else to look?

Suggest that you start with the Qlik Support article Timeout Values Related to QlikView Deployment and focus on the entries for QVS and QVWS. Another issue may be if you have a network load balancer in play in the environment. If so, be sure that session persistence, or "sticky sessions", is enabled on the NLB.
